Seven Predictions Covering Key Inflection Points in CyberSecurity, AI Regulations, Robotics, Blockchain, Immersive Tech, 3D Printing and Neurodiversity

ANN ARBOR, Mich., Jan. 7, 2025 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- Renowned technology strategist and author Professor Timothy E. Bates, affectionately known as The Godfather of Tech, has unveiled his technology predictions for 2025. Drawing from his unparalleled expertise as a noted Chief Technology Officer across AI, blockchain, cybersecurity, and immersive technologies, Bates has identified key tipping points that will redefine industries, homes, and lives.

These insights are rooted in seven groundbreaking trends that are shaping the technology sector:

1. Ransomware's Next Wave: Safeguarding a Generative AI-Driven World

With the proliferation of generative AI systems, Bates warns that ransomware will evolve from a corporate nuisance to a household threat. He calls for robust security measures, user education, and proactive updates to mitigate risks.

"The same Gen AI that simplifies life can also open the door to unprecedented vulnerabilities," he cautions. As a result, secure-by-design systems are not optional. They are essential."

2. Global AI Regulations: Striking the Balance Between Unity and Adaptability

As AI adoption skyrockets, the world faces a critical challenge: creating global standards while respecting local nuances. Bates calls for a flexible, collaborative framework to address issues like bias and cultural insensitivity in AI systems.

"AI knows no borders, but its impact is deeply personal," Bates states. "I would urge global leaders to prioritize inclusivity and ethical development."

3. Blockchain Beyond Cryptocurrency: Building Secure Digital Futures

Moving beyond cryptocurrency, blockchain is emerging as a cornerstone for public safety, digital identity, and transparent governance. Bates highlights pioneering cities like Austin, Reno and Detroit, which are leveraging blockchain for secure recordkeeping, voting integrity, and smart city initiatives.

"Blockchain isn't just for coins—it's the key to a zero-trust, secure digital landscape," says Bates."It will protect the digital futures of everyday Americans so privacy, security, and trust are baked into the services we all rely on."

4. AI and Robotics: AI Empowers Robotics for Workplace Safety

Generative AI is revolutionizing robotics by replacing complex programming with natural language prompts, making robot operations as simple as giving verbal instructions. This transformation removes entry barriers, enabling workers in industries like manufacturing, logistics, and healthcare to program robots in real-time without technical expertise.

"Generative AI is breaking down the complexity of robotics, allowing anyone to deploy robots safely and efficiently," Bates predicts. "By automating dangerous and repetitive tasks, this technology enhances workplace safety, reduces injuries, and creates a more accessible and efficient future for industries worldwide. From warehouses to hospitals, AI-driven robotics paves the way for a safer, smarter, and more inclusive future."

5. The Rise of Neurodiversity: The New Superpower and Competitive Edge

Bates underscores the transformative power of neurodivergent minds in innovation. From ADHD-driven creativity to dyslexic problem-solving, he believes 2025 will mark the year businesses fully embrace neurodiverse talent as a strategic advantage.

"Different thinkers lead to different solutions," Bates asserts. "Neurodiversity will become the superpower that unlocks the next wave of breakthroughs."

6. 3D Printing at Home: The Star Trek Replicator Comes to Life

In 2025, 3D printers will transition from niche tools to household staples, empowering individuals to manufacture toys, tools, and even food from their desktops. Bates celebrates this democratization of innovation, predicting a wave of creativity and self-sufficiency.

"We're entering an era where if it breaks, you don't replace it—you print it," he says. "Today's printers are real-life versions of science fiction's 'Star Trek' replicators."

7. From Physical to Digital: The Role of Immersive Technology in Creating a Sustainable Future

Immersive technology has been a dream for nearly two centuries, and in 2025, it will become part of daily life through tools like digital twins, extended reality (XR), and the metaverse. From revolutionizing education and enterprise training to enhancing creativity, these advancements will transform how we live, learn, and work.

"In 2025, immersive technology will transform daily life, with tools like digital twins and extended reality revolutionizing education, work, and creativity," Bates says. "As we move beyond headsets, fully interactive holographic experiences will make immersion seamless and accessible, turning the once-imaginary metaverse into a practical reality for businesses and consumers alike. The future is immersive, and it's here to stay."

About Professor Timothy E. Bates

Professor Bates (a.k.a The Godfather of Tech) was discovered at the age of 13 by the U.S. Marshals Service as a hacker and later recruited by the U.S. Government to train and educate them on how to track down digital pirates and other hackers. The Godfather of Tech has a passion that extends beyond his extensive expertise in Artificial Intelligence (AI), Blockchain, and Immersive Technologies. His stunning resume includes positions like Chief Technology Officer (CTO) at Global Fortune 200 companies, such as Lenovo, (ranked The World's Most Admired company by Fortune Magazine) and America's Top Automaker, General Motors. At General Motors, he led groundbreaking projects like the company's software-defined ecosystem for the Hummer Electric and digital twinning of vehicles to solve problems during the iterative process long before the manufacturing began. His technical expertise is sought-after and utilized by market-leading organizations, such as Deloitte & Touché LLP, Price Waterhouse Coopers, Dow Chemical, the US Marshals Service, and the US Marine Corps. He currently serves as a Fractional CTO to several emerging technology start-ups and is a Professor of Practice for the University of Michigan, College of Innovation and Technology.

The Godfather of Tech has received several awards recognizing his contributions and leadership in the technology field. Notably, he has been honored with the BEYA Black Engineers Association Award: Modern-Day Technology Leader, which acknowledges his innovative work and leadership in modern technology developments. He has also received a CIO Award for the GM Layers of Defense Strategy, recognizing his strategic contributions to cybersecurity and defense mechanisms at General Motors. Furthermore, Bates has been distinguished with a CEO Award for Technical Fellow: Immersive Strategy, highlighting his pioneering work in immersive technology strategies. He has received Military Commendations for cybersecurity-related activities, acknowledging his contributions to cybersecurity in a military context.

Most importantly he makes time to provide leadership to underserved communities through his work with nonprofits, including Black Tech Saturdays and Taste of Tech.
